12/13/11Marshall County REMC is once again promoting the Electric Consumer Student Calendar Art Contest. Indiana’s young Picassos who wish to put paint to canvas and pencil or crayon to paper are encouraged to enter the 2013 Calendar Art Contest. Entries are currently being accepted.      Deadline for entries is March 23.

The contest, in its 15th year, provides young Hoosier artists a unique opportunity to develop and showcase their talent. Electric Consumer — the statewide publication for Indiana’s electric cooperatives —sponsors the program, which is open to all kindergarten through 12th grade Indiana students.

Students are invited to submit original artwork reflective of the calendar month for which their grade level is assigned. For example, high school seniors would submit artwork for the month of December.

Entries are then judged and winners from each grade selected. Those winners then represent the specific month in the “2013 Cooperative Calendar of Student Art.” Nine honorable mention winners are also included in a special section of the calendar.

Not only will the contest winners have their artwork published in the calendar, which is viewed by thousands of electric cooperative members across the state, they and their winning pieces will be honored at a special reception through a partnership with the Hoosier Salon.

The Hoosier Salon, headquartered in Indianapolis, is a statewide nonprofit arts organization whose mission is to create an appreciation of visual art by promoting Hoosier artists and their art. In addition, the students’ artwork will tour the Hoosier Salon’s galleries in Indianapolis, New Harmony and Wabash.

“As school systems across America continue to cut funding to, or even eliminate, art programs, Indiana’s electric cooperatives are thrilled to offer our young artists a forum to spotlight their talent through our art contest and through our partnership with the Hoosier Salon,” said Emily Schilling, Electric Consumer editor.

Electric Consumer, based in Indianapolis and the voice of Indiana’s electric cooperatives, is distributed to nearly 226,000 electric cooperative member-owners throughout the state of Indiana. For more information, go to www.electricconsumer.org .

The Indiana Statewide Association of Rural Electric Cooperatives, publisher of the Electric Consumer, represents 39 electric cooperatives that serve 89 of the state’s 92 counties. For more information on Indiana Statewide and its members, visit www.indremc s.org.
